了解在页面上去SQL数据库查询要绑定的数据方法
快速了解在页面上去SQL数据库查询要绑定的数据方法
1, 想在页面上的表格绑定数据库的数据时,那么我们就知道我们的数据是在数据库的。
我们要写代码去找到他们,并且把它带到我们的页面上。
下面我就举个例子来说明一下
- 比如我要在页面上的这样一个leyui的表格绑定我所要绑定我想要的字段的数据,如图所示
在这个表格里,我要一个列是选择列,这个是layui自带的样式可以在JS代码里写上就可以出来,序号也是一样,我们要手动查的字段有歌手,歌手的性别,以及歌手对应的歌曲名称,歌曲对应的专辑,还有歌曲的类型。
在我的数据里我是分了4个表,分别是歌手表,歌曲表,专辑表,歌曲类型表。要查询他们其中的一些字段,就可以把他们之间把他们连起来,下面我在SQL中进行他们之间关系的连接,如图所示。
歌手表是PW_Singer, 歌曲表是SYS_Song, 歌曲类型表是SYS_SongType,专辑表是SYS_DVD。
-
歌手有对应的歌曲以及专辑,所以歌曲表和专辑表是靠歌手ID进行连接的
-
歌曲有歌曲类型,所以歌曲类型表是靠歌曲ID跟歌曲表进行连接。
这样一来,四张表就可以连起来了。这样一来,我就可以查询这四张表里的任意我想要的字段,任何把他们放在页面上去显示出来,这里我需要的字段有歌手表里面的歌手名称和里面的歌手性别,以及歌曲表的歌曲名称,专辑表的专辑名称,歌曲类型表里面的类型,以及一些用来方便操作而查询的ID。 -
在mvc项目的VS控制器中的代码如下:
-
最后在在视图上用上layui的插件,在用Js渲染表格就可以绑定查询出来的数据了,代码如下
5 最后效果